Linux下数据库安全与稳定环境构建策略
|
AI绘图,仅供参考 在Linux系统中构建数据库的安全与稳定环境,是保障数据完整性和服务连续性的关键。应从基础的系统配置入手,确保操作系统本身具备良好的安全机制。例如,关闭不必要的服务和端口,使用防火墙(如iptables或nftables)限制外部访问,可以有效减少潜在的攻击面。数据库软件的安装和配置同样至关重要。选择官方源或可信的第三方仓库进行安装,避免使用不可靠的来源。同时,遵循最小权限原则,为数据库账户分配必要的权限,避免使用root用户直接操作数据库,以降低风险。 定期更新系统和数据库软件,是维护安全的重要手段。通过yum、apt等工具及时应用补丁,可以修复已知漏洞,防止恶意攻击者利用旧版本中的缺陷。开启日志记录功能,对数据库的操作行为进行审计,有助于及时发现异常活动。 备份策略也是确保数据库稳定性的核心环节。制定合理的备份计划,包括全量备份和增量备份,并将备份文件存储在安全的位置,如异地服务器或云存储中。定期测试恢复流程,确保在发生故障时能够快速恢复数据。 监控和告警系统的部署能提升数据库运行的可靠性。使用如Prometheus、Zabbix等工具实时监控数据库性能和状态,设置阈值触发告警,可以帮助运维人员在问题发生前采取措施,避免服务中断。 (编辑:开发网_商丘站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330475号